Fatima , thanks for taking the time to share your stories with us today Can you recount a story of an unexpected problem you’ve faced along the way?
The most unexpected problem I’ve faced while being in the film industry was the 2023 strike. One by the Writers Guild of America & the other by the Screen Actors Guild. The strikes led to a shutdown of many tv and film productions impacting the entertainment industry as a whole
. The strikes started May 2023 and concluded in late November. I’d just gave birth to my son in February 2023 and went back to work to film Bad Boys Ride or Die in April, due to the strike we were shut down in June. It was a very scary time, not knowing when we would return to work.

My name is Fatima Stripling and I’m a Set Costumer/Personal Costumer in the Wardrobe department in the film industry. I’ve been in the industry for 12 years which is such a blessing. The film industry was introduced to me by one if my good friends by way of an internship prior to me graduating college. It was a great experience and I knew that there was no going back! I am most proud of “Light, Camera & Action”, my costume class that I teach to non-union members. There’s so many moving parts in the costume department, which allows creativity & teamwork. Is there a particular goal or mission driving your creative journey?
My ultimate goal to be a Personal Costumer to one actor by being in their contract. This means that I would only work and take care of this actor on set. As a new mother this would benefit me in more ways than one.
